thanks -simon On Mon, Apr 18, 2011 at 9:26 AM, Robert Maynard <[email protected]>wrote: > Hi Simon, > > I have attached an example CMakeLists.txt that support external library > linking and include directories. Since you are linking to a static build of > HDF5 you will need to manually add each library > to VISIT_PLUGIN_EXTERNAL_LIBS separated by semicolons. > > > On Mon, Apr 11, 2011 at 5:19 PM, Simon Su <[email protected]> wrote: > >> Hi Robert, >> >> It worked. adding the other file listed under my Files components="M" xml >> block solve the error when the plugin manager tries to loader the plugin. >> >> So I went and try to load my file in ParaView ... but this is what I >> got.... >> >> >> sms:/local/home/build/paraview-plugin/gfdl-paraview-loader-build> paraview >> /local/home/tools/ParaView/ParaView-3.10.0/sms.Linux-2.6.18-194.26.1.el5.x86_64.gcc-4.1.2.release/lib/paraview-3.10/paraview: >> symbol lookup error: >> /local/home/build/paraview-plugin/gfdl-paraview-loader-build/libVisItReaderGFDL.so: >> undefined symbol: nc_inq_attlen >> >> >> The question now is, where in ccmake can I specify for the plugin when it >> is compiling to also include libnetcdf.a libhdf5_hl.a libhdf5.a libsz.a >> libraries?
